Heart Sound is one of the oldest means for assessing the function of its valves. It helps, together with Echocardiograms and Electrocardiographs, giving a clear and proper diagnostic of several diseases. In this paper artificial neural networks are used to classify several valves-related heart disorders. A library of heart sound files, recorded via the traditional Stethoscope, are used to extract relevant features using several signal processing tools e.g Discrete Wavelet Transfer (DWT), Fast Fourier Transform (FFT) and Linear Prediction Coding (LPC). The achieved recognition rates were around 95.7%.
